Address

1DbY65Ng65t2xrAZt9xVpNbACw2Cj8XMWpCopy

Total Received

1.17135156 BTC

Total Sent

1.17135156 BTC

№ Transactions

6

Final Balance

0 BTC

Transactions
Filter